Webb23 juni 2015 · Bursa injection involve injection of a local anesthetic with 40-80 mg of steroids like methylprednisolone acetate or triamcilone acetonide into the bursa. The injection can be repeated at 4-6 weeks, if pain relief has been less than 50%. Bursa injections are well taken and very few post-injection complications are reported. The … order of hpi

Webb20 maj 2024 · Cortisone shots are injections that can help relieve pain and inflammation in a specific area of your body. They're most commonly injected into joints — such as your ankle, elbow, hip, knee, shoulder, spine or wrist. Even the small joints in your hands or feet might benefit from cortisone shots. Webb14 aug. 2024 · Generally, common marathon injuries that respond to cortisone include joint swelling and tendon-related pain from overload. Common conditions that work well with a cortisone shot are patellofemoral pain (or runner’s knee), IT band syndrome, knee arthritis, and greater trochanteric pain syndrome (or hip bursitis).
